The Bard's Tale may refer to:

  • Dragon Wars (1991) was originally slated to be The Bard's Tale IV, but became a separate title (with a new name and changes to the storyline) at a very late point in its development process, due to rights issues after developer Interplay parted ways with publisher Electronic Arts.
  • The Bard's Tale (2004 video game), an action role-playing video game created by Brian Fargo, and published by Fargo's InXile Entertainment in 2004, was named for the famous Bard's Tale series but is not a proper part thereof; Brian Fargo only had the rights to the name but not to the content/stories of the earlier games in the series at that point.
  • The Bard's Tale IV, a proper fourth part of the original series, albeit with a somewhat different, more modern gameplay, was successfully funded as a Kickstarter project in 2016 by InXile Entertainment.
